Abstract

Fossil fuels have been the major energy resource of the world. However, the gaseous that produced by combustion of fuel is poisonous and it can lead to health problems for living things. This paper review the main factors which contribute to the combustion of the burner system. The main parameters considered are flame length, flame height, flame area, flame temperature and emission of gases. The first part of this study recaps on the flame characters. The second part discuss the effects of on the flame temperature of the burner system. The final section discusses the emission characteristics on emissions of nitrogen oxide, carbon monoxide, sulphur dioxide and carbon dioxide. The outcome of this paper provides an understanding of the combustion characteristics towards the performance of burner system.
